When AI Removes Administrative Friction
Why digital government may need to move from citizen navigation to intent-centred service delivery
AI may not simply create demand for government services. It may expose demand that administrative friction previously concealed — and that changes the interface between citizen and institution.
The question agentic flooding raises
A recent paper by Chris Schmitz, Lewis Hammond and Alan Chan, Characterizing Agentic Flooding of Government Services [1], examines what happens when AI lowers the effort required to interact with public services.
The authors identify 84 potential cases across 11 jurisdictions where AI may have contributed to increases in the volume or complexity of interactions. They call the phenomenon agentic flooding.
That is the paper’s finding. It is exploratory. It does not prove that AI caused every increase in the dataset, and the authors are careful about those limits.
My question is different.
What if AI is not simply creating demand for government services? What if it is revealing demand that administrative friction previously suppressed?
Friction as hidden demand regulation
We usually treat administrative friction as inconvenience: a difficult form, unclear eligibility, specialist language, several agencies, repeated evidence requests.
Friction also regulates access.
A person may qualify for assistance and never find it. Another may abandon an application because the process is too hard to understand. Others may not know how to describe their circumstances in the language the institution expects.
The paper describes these barriers in terms of learning costs, compliance costs and psychological costs. AI can reduce all three. It can interpret rules, explain terminology, prepare documentation and turn ordinary language into institutionally recognisable language.
That changes the economics of interacting with government.
The operational question is then not only how to stop AI-generated volume. It is what happens when technology removes the burden that was quietly rationing legitimate access.
Recreating that friction — fees, channel restrictions, higher evidentiary hurdles — may sometimes be necessary against abuse. It is a strange form of digital transformation if it becomes the default. The same barrier that slows machine-generated flooding can also deter the people digital government was meant to serve.
Citizens still carry the organisation chart
Most public services still begin from the structure of government: departments, programs, portals, forms, schemes and jurisdictions. The citizen is expected to translate a human situation into that structure.
Someone starts with a problem such as: “My mother can no longer look after herself and I need to understand what help is available.” Before getting an answer, they may need to determine which level of government is responsible, which agency owns the service, which programs apply, what evidence is required, and which terminology the institution recognises.
Life does not arrive in administrative categories. Digitisation has often moved the same navigation online. We digitised the institution. We did not necessarily redesign the interaction around the person.
Start with intent, not the institution
Natural language makes a different starting point possible.
Not “Which government service are you looking for?” but “What are you trying to achieve?”
That is more than placing a chatbot on an existing website. A chatbot can make a known service easier to find. The larger opportunity is an interface that can establish intent and then discover which institutional capabilities are relevant to it.
Language is the interface — not the authority. Intent still has to be established clearly enough to assemble context, check what is permitted, and prepare work that can be reviewed.
Government can remain complicated behind that interface. The citizen should not have to experience all of that complexity in order to be helped.
Assemble existing capability around intent
The problem is often not that capability is missing. Governments already have legislation, policy, programs, case-management systems, registers, delegations, digital services and people authorised to decide.
The person needing help is still expected to find and assemble those pieces.
That is an architectural problem of discovery, not a requirement to rebuild the state. Existing systems, knowledge and professional judgement can be assembled around expressed intent rather than requiring the citizen to navigate the organisation chart first.

Structured intent, not generated volume
One of the paper’s more useful observations is that current examples do not generally look like autonomous agents attacking public services. Much of the effect appears to come from something simpler: generative AI has made sophisticated text cheap.
If citizens produce more material, government then spends more effort interpreting that material. Neither side necessarily needs more words. They need a better shared representation of the request.
The useful shift is from an AI-generated document arriving in a queue, toward structured intent: verified context, relevant evidence, applicable rules, the right capability, and a request that the institution can act on.
Natural language can still be how a person explains their circumstances. It does not have to mean unlimited generated prose.
Judgement remains institutional
Making capability easier to reach does not mean allowing a model to exercise public authority.
Interpretation is not authority. Prediction is not judgement. Language generation is not accountability.
A system might help understand what someone is asking, surface relevant policy, assemble permitted information, explain options or route a request. Consequential judgement remains with authorised people and the institutions that hold that authority.
The path from intent to outcome can be flexible. The accountability around that path cannot be optional. Who had authority, what evidence and rules applied, which capabilities were engaged, and how the result was reached still have to be explainable.
Do not boil the ocean
This does not require replacing every legacy system, standardising every dataset or building one national platform.
Begin with bounded journeys. Reuse what already exists. Let AI interpret language where interpretation helps, search where discovery is needed, and assemble context where context is fragmented. Do not treat the model as the institution.

AI may be exposing institutional design debt
The authors’ caution about their dataset still matters. Agentic flooding is a glimpse, not a census.
Even so, the pattern is instructive. When the cost of interacting with an institution falls, processes that once required specialist knowledge become easier to attempt. Some of that will be abuse. Some will be noise. Some will be operational pressure. Some may be people finally being able to ask.
If demand was manageable because access was difficult, the weakness was not created by the model. Complexity was being carried by citizens. AI may be exposing that design debt.
From digital government to intent-centred government
The first generation of digital government largely put existing services online. The next may require a different relationship:
From “Here are our services. Find the one that applies to you.”
To “Tell us what you are trying to achieve. We will help determine what capabilities apply.”
That starts with the person rather than the organisation chart. It uses technology to absorb institutional complexity rather than transferring that complexity back to the public. It preserves judgement and accountability rather than assuming that everything capable of being automated should be.
The most important question raised by agentic flooding may therefore not be how governments stop AI from generating too much demand. It may be what government should look like when administrative friction is no longer the thing regulating access.
We can begin with intent. And assemble the institution around it.
